- [ ] Step 7: Archive cold storage buckets (Glacierline tier). Confirm both ceremony witnesses are present, verify bucket manifests match the Oxbow ledger, then seal the archive key shares. Plugin authors may observe but not handle shares. Once sealed, the archive index itself is encrypted and can only be reopened with the passphrase below.

vault phrase of badup-hahig = tamael-aldael-kelmir-istael-fenok-istwyn-tamius-jorath-oliion

Start by wrapping the existing script as a Weftline task with an explicit timeout — cron's silent overruns are the main thing we're escaping. Define retries conservatively (two attempts, exponential backoff) and declare any upstream dependencies so the scheduler can order runs correctly. Keep the old cron entry commented out for one sprint as a fallback. Do not delete it until the workflow has succeeded ten consecutive times. The step-by-step migration template is maintained on the page below.

dashboard of bafof-hafog = https://confluence.lumiclabs.internal/display/browse/display/6a09a20a

## Formula sandbox tuning

User-supplied formulas in Gridmoor execute inside a restricted interpreter with hard ceilings on time, memory, and call depth. Reviewers should confirm any change to these ceilings is justified in the PR description, since raising them widens the abuse surface. Defaults were chosen from production traces. The current limits are as follows.

limits module of tafog-fawip:
WEIGHTS = {
    "julix": 57,
    "lamys": 992,
    "kasvan": 209,
    "quenok": 750,
    "alddor": 259,
    "oliath": 1009,
    "wenix": 815,
}